The Importance Of Radiator Valve Actuators In Efficient Heating Systems

radiator valve actuators play a crucial role in regulating the flow of hot water in heating systems, ensuring efficient heating and maximum comfort for occupants. These small yet powerful devices are placed on top of radiator valves and help control the temperature in individual rooms or zones. One of the main advantages of radiator valve actuators is their ability to provide individual room control. Instead of heating the entire building to the same temperature, these devices allow occupants to set different temperatures in each room or zone. This level of customization ensures that each area is heated according to its specific needs, leading to greater comfort and energy savings. For example, rooms that are rarely used can be kept at a lower temperature, while living spaces can be heated to a comfortable level.

In addition to individual room control, radiator valve actuators also enable zoning within a building. This means that different areas can be grouped together and controlled separately from the rest of the building. For instance, the living room and kitchen can be grouped in one zone, while the bedrooms are in another. By creating these zones, occupants can further optimize their heating system and tailor it to their lifestyle and usage patterns. This not only improves comfort but also reduces energy wastage and promotes sustainability.

Another benefit of radiator valve actuators is their ability to respond to changing conditions in real-time. These devices are equipped with sensors that detect variations in temperature and automatically adjust the flow of hot water to maintain the desired room temperature. This means that heating systems can adapt to external factors such as sunlight, occupancy, and weather changes, ensuring optimal comfort and efficiency at all times. As a result, occupants can enjoy consistent heating without the need for manual adjustments.
